  • Abstract
    CARS and SRE of radicals created by photodissociation were attempted using a laser system with a 1 cm−1 bandwidth. The difficulty of observing these spectra due to interference from non-resonant background and the resulting asymmetric CARS lineshape is discussed and demonstrated with N2O, HS and OH. Polarization filtering techniques are described and improvements resulting from their use are presented. The HS radical, which has a Raman frequency on the low energy side of the H2S precursor molecule, could not be detected, while OH, which has a Raman frequency on the high energy side of the HNO3 precursor molecule, was easily observed.
